Source Tissue

EC Number Source Tissue Comment Organism Textmining
3.2.1.4 additional information pretreated rice straw and commercial cellulose, Solka Floc, are used as carbon sources for cellulase production, no enzyme activity with hot-compressed water treated rice straw as carbon source, optimization of culture conditions for growth on rice straw, overview Talaromyces pinophilus
-

Specific Activity [micromol/min/mg]

EC Number Specific Activity Minimum [µmol/min/mg] Specific Activity Maximum [µmol/min/mg] Comment Organism
3.2.1.4 11.02
-
carboxymethyl cellulase, pH 4.8, 45°C, culture from cutter-milled rice straw as carbon source Talaromyces pinophilus
3.2.1.4 16.76
-
carboxymethyl cellulase, pH 4.8, 45°C, culture from Solka Floc as carbon source Talaromyces pinophilus
3.2.1.4 18.63
-
carboxymethyl cellulase, pH 4.8, 45°C, culture from dry ball-milled rice straw as carbon source Talaromyces pinophilus
3.2.1.4 19.73
-
carboxymethyl cellulase, pH 4.8, 45°C, culture from freeze-dried rice straw after wet disk milling at 7 days as carbon source Talaromyces pinophilus
